Output ef2de24c4b4f798b395940ddf60ebbd352766c419a8bad53257e9e67b0d450f2:1

value
5305573
script pubkey
OP_0 OP_PUSHBYTES_20 5c996c5366f3f4aa4829498cbdb7f52406dcc756
address
bc1qtjvkc5mx70625jpffxxtmdl4ysrde36kpdfslq
transaction
ef2de24c4b4f798b395940ddf60ebbd352766c419a8bad53257e9e67b0d450f2
confirmations
152528
spent
true